Output 8661a93f05973d867fe0d84652594667bb818c0cc3205d09f92b31ca041a56b8:1

value
1205895866
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ba8cbc59d9365379b242d1db5466223bec4dbe84 OP_EQUAL
address
3JhQCiSRbxmkFxHWT7ft2CeztpMmzJXo7a
transaction
8661a93f05973d867fe0d84652594667bb818c0cc3205d09f92b31ca041a56b8
confirmations
565116
spent
true